As noted in a number of observational and modeling studies, the last decades witnessed a positive trend in zonal wind speed over the Southern Ocean, combined with a southward shift in the location of the zone of the highest wind speeds (i.e., prevalence of the positive phase of the SAM index 21 22 ).
